Description

Combine fractions or percents with voting. This is a quick way to infuse a little math into a regular poll or vote. Choose a yes-or-no question for the group vote, such as: Should we have apples or bananas for snack today? Explain that the group will go with whatever at least 75% chooses. If no choice received enough votes, debate the options and try again. Available as a web page or downloadable pdf.
